Whether on a field, on ice, or underwater, athletic activity is much more than an exhibition of physical dexterity or a battle of brawn. Athletes, both amateur and professional, must synthesize strategy and grace to succeed. These exciting volumes examine the evolution of various sports—from the camaraderie of team sports, such as hockey, volleyball, and lacrosse, to the more individualized pursuits of racecar driving, martial arts, and extreme sports—and the journeys of their most exceptional competitors. Nonfiction content about sports that meets students’ need for complex informational texts. Helps students meet writing standards by creating informative texts with source material on a highly engaging subject matter. Detailed biographies highlight the accomplishments of major players. Annotated diagrams illustrate playing fields and relevant concepts. Contact information for relevant organizations and online resources are included in each volume.
